Selection process
There is no competitive pitch or jury round. Applications first go through a screening step, where residency, unreserved category status, age, family income and possession of a valid driving licence are checked against the scheme's conditions.
Beyond that screening, no detailed selection method is published. What the scheme does state clearly is a ceiling: a maximum of five beneficiaries per village. Where demand within a village exceeds that number, the choice among eligible applicants is likely to be made on merit or by lottery, though the scheme does not specify which.
The process is completed offline. Once the online application is submitted, a signed printout of the form, together with physical copies of the uploaded documents, goes to the Deputy Director (Non-Reserved Category) or the District Social Welfare Officer — by courier, post, or in person during working hours.
